    Nope, Toyota does not do traditional ordering, you can't build a Tacoma like a pizza or domestic vehicle. Each region has allocations and each regions allocations are built to the configs that region decides on (reason you can't find a particular config in some regions), your dealer will then snag an allocation based on what you are looking for or if not an allocation for that particular region put in a special allocation request, which requires approval and takes longer.

    Gonna bet the price is similar to 2020 there bud. No real additional features or options, unless you're talking about the trail or nightshade editions. Only time prices moved significantly were in 2017 when they added the pwr rear slider, 2018 when the prem package got split up and leather/TSS was added, 2020 with addition of LEDs, new packages, etc, even then I think a base model TRD only went up $200 in MSRP.
